COLUMBUS, OHIO, February 24, 2008 - Buckeye Travel Hockey League, comprised of hockey associations from West Virginia, Kentucky, Ohio and Indiana, announced their first All League Honors for their two 18 year old and under divisions.
Both divisions, utilizing coaches' voting and awarding points for goals and assists, named a first and second line all league team with an additional 13 players receiving honorable mention. In the AA division players were selected from among 6 teams and 117 players while honorees for the A division were selected from 7 teams and 132 players.

The Buckeye Travel Hockey League is in its thirteenth year and provides the opportunity for children from Mites (8 and under) through Midgets (18 and under), to develop their hockey skills while playing top teams from other cities within the USA Hockey defined Mid Am district of Indiana, Kentucky, Ohio, West Virginia and Western Pennsylvania.

As most of you know by now at the Annual Buckeye League Meeting a pre-season seeding tournament was approved. This has been two years in the making and I am very excited that this is finally completed. Please see the attached final addition of the completed proposal. There are some important dates everyone needs to be aware of.
August 24th all registration fees are due along with team registration sheet. A new registration sheet will be posted soon. It is very important to have this in to the competition comm. prior to that date as we only have 4 days to post the pre-season rankings and to post the tournament schedule on September 1. Your cooperation with this very important date will be greatly appreciated.
All scrimmage games will be played on Sept. 15 or 16. Each team will play four 30-minute games on only one day. After the tournament is completed divisions will be posted on Sept. 18. All teams will have until Sept. 20 to petition for a change of division. On Sept. 23 all final divisions will be posted and the scheduling meeting will be Sept. 29.
